SKL Trading Market Making Platform
Project Description
The SKL Trading Market Making Platform was developed to optimize trading strategies and provide liquidity across multiple financial exchanges. This project involved a complete rewrite of the platform, focusing on a modular design using ZeroMQ and Node.js (TypeScript) to enhance scalability, flexibility, and performance.
Key Features:
- Exchange Connectivity: Integrates a variety of exchange connectivity solutions to streamline trading operations.
- Operational Monitoring: Utilizes Prometheus for real-time metrics and Grafana for data visualization, offering deep insights into market operations.
- Seamless Connectivity and Performance: Designed for high performance, real-time visibility, and reliable market-making operations.
Role Description
As the Senior Lead Developer, I led the complete rewrite of the market-making platform, focusing on modularity and scalability. My responsibilities included:
- Platform Architecture: Designed a modular architecture with ZeroMQ and Node.js (TypeScript), enabling scalability and flexibility for future enhancements.
- Exchange Connectivity: Oversaw the development of exchange connectivity solutions, streamlining integration with various trading platforms.
- Operational Monitoring: Integrated Prometheus metrics across the platform for real-time operational insights and implemented Grafana dashboards for data visualization.
- Kubernetes Migration: Planned and executed the migration of the platform to Kubernetes, unlocking greater scalability, reliability, and high availability to handle increasing workloads.
Key Achievements:
- Delivered a highly scalable and flexible platform capable of supporting complex market-making operations.
- Enhanced operational transparency with real-time monitoring and visualization tools.
- Streamlined liquidity management for clients through an intuitive and feature-rich UI.
- Increased platform resilience and performance through Kubernetes-based deployment.
